Research On Safety Situation Assessment Method Of Regional Construction Industry

In recent years,the pillar role of the construction industry in my country’s national economy has become more obvious,and the future development of the construction industry depends not only on the strategic development plan of the construction industry and enterprises but also on the level of my country’s macroeconomic development.Therefore,an objective and accurate description of the safety development level of the construction industry from a macro level is the prerequisite for the government to formulate development strategies for the construction industry.To more comprehensively consider the current safety status of the construction industry and predict the future safety trend from time and space,this article introduces the concept and method of situation assessment into the construction industry,explores the method of regional safety situation assessment in the construction industry,and provides the safety situation of the construction industry.The assessment provides new theories,which have guiding significance for the safe development of the construction industry.First,based on the research of relevant literature,introduce the concept of situation assessment into the construction industry,and define the concepts of construction industry safety situation and construction industry regional safety situation assessment separately;Secondly,combined with the characteristics of the construction industry safety situation,from the perspectives of population,resources,economy,accidents,etc.,three situational subsystems of construction industry regional safety,construction industry regional development,and regional economic development are extracted as first-level indicators,and the construction industry Accident status,industry scale,economic benefits of the construction industry,technical level,regional economic development,5 secondary indicators and 16 tertiary indicators to construct the construction industry regional safety situation assessment index system,and use the game theory combination weighting method to calculate the weight of the evaluation index system;Third,the security situation is divided into four levels,and the construction industry regional security situation assessment model based on cloud matter element theory and the construction industry regional security situation prediction model based on gray BP neural network is constructed;Finally,the article takes the safety situation of the construction industry in Shaanxi Province as an example to conduct an empirical analysis.Based on the "China Statistical Yearbook" and "Shaanxi Provincial Statistical Yearbook" and other documents,the relevant index data of Shaanxi Province from 2009 to 2019 is calculated,and the safety situation assessment model is applied to evaluate Shaanxi.The safety situation of the construction industry in Shaanxi Province in the past 11 years.The study found that the safety situation of the construction industry in Shaanxi Province in the past 11 years was at an average of Ⅱ(safer)level;the results of the situation in 2009-2018 were carried out through the gray BP neural network prediction model.After training,predicting the safety situation of the construction industry in the next three years,and verifying it with the predicted value in 2019,it was found that the prediction result was more accurate.The main value of this paper is to introduce the concept of situation assessment into the construction industry,and demonstrate the research on the regional safety situation assessment method of the construction industry,construct the regional safety situation assessment model and prediction model of the construction industry,and use Shaanxi Province 2009-2019 The data has been empirically analyzed.The research results can provide theoretical support and technical support for the construction industry safety situation assessment of government departments.
